How much does a Vo-Tech Inc Director, Development make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Director, Development at Vo-Tech Inc is $99,292, which translates to approximately $48 per hour. Salaries for Director, Development at Vo-Tech Inc typically range from $80,734 to $126,089,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Vo-Tech, Inc. provides complete manufacturing services including designing, engineering, machining and fabrication for a wide array of industries. We implement innovative processes and provide optimal solutions to manufacture precision parts, components and machines. With our unique engineering skills, machining expertise, and a commitment to quality, we desire to develop lasting partnerships with our customers. At Vo-Tech we don't just manufacture products, we exceed customer expectations! We specialize in: High & Low Volume Production Contract Machining Engineering Prototyping 3D Printing Reverse Engineering Complete Product Development Field Machining Laser Engraving Wire EDM CMM Part Inspection Finishing Services Grinding Sheet Metal & Pipe Fabrication

Fundraising: Fundraising or fund-raising (also known as "development" or "advancement") is the process of seeking and gathering voluntary financial contributions by engaging individuals, businesses, charitable foundations, or governmental agencies. Although fundraising typically refers to efforts to gather money for non-profit organizations, it is sometimes used to refer to the identification and solicitation of investors or other sources of capital for for-profit enterprises. Traditionally, fundraising consisted mostly of asking for donations on the street or at people's doors, and this is experiencing very strong growth in the form of face-to-face fundraising, but new forms of fundraising, such as online fundraising, have emerged in recent years, though these are often based on older methods such as grassroots fundraising.

Lincolnwood, IL (13,463) is seeking a knowledgeable and collaborative leader to oversee its Community Development Department, guiding planning, zoning, and economic development initiatives to support the Village's growth and vitality. The Village is seeking an assertive professional to focus on economic development and key redevelopment opportunities. The department has eight (8) full-time employees, one (1) part-time intern, and contracts with SAFEbuilt for building inspections and plan review services. The Director is an integral part of the Village's leadership team, with responsibilities including oversight of critical functions, such as planning, zoning, permitting, building code review and interpretation, code enforcement, and building construction inspection. The department has responsibilities for advisory boards and commissions, including providing staff assistance to the Plan Commission/Zoning Board of Appeals and the Economic Development Commission.
